قم بمتابعة الفيديو أدناه لمعرفة كيفية تثبيت موقعنا كتطبيق ويب على الشاشة الرئيسية.
ملاحظة: قد لا تكون هذه الميزة متاحة في بعض المتصفحات.
ملف Robots.txt هو ملف نصي يستخدم للتحكم في كيفية وصول روبوتات محركات البحث إلى أجزاء معينة من موقعك على الويب.
ومن أهم الفوائد هي باستخدام هذا الملف، والذي يمكنك من منع محركات البحث من فهرسة صفحات معينة أو توجيهها إلى الصفحات التي ترغب في فهرستها حسب اختيارك.
<div id="grobot"> <div class="at_robottxt_container"><h1>Generate robots.txt</h1> <label class="at_level" for="website-url">Website URL:</label> <input class="at_input" type="text" id="website-url" placeholder="Enter Your Website URL with ‘https://’"><br> <label for="platform-select">Platform:</label> <select id="platform-select"> <option value="blogger">Blogger</option> <option value="wordpress">WordPress</option> </select><br> <button id="generate-btn">Generate</button><br><br> <div id="output-container" style="display:none"> <p id="output-text"></p> <button id="copy-btn" style="display:none">Copy to clipboard</button> </div> <style> * { margin: 0; padding: 0px; box-sizing: border-box; } body { background: #fff; } #grobot { width: 50vh; max-width: 90%; margin: 40px auto; border: 2px solid black; } .at_robottxt_container h1 { text-align: center; margin: 50px 0; font-size: 36px; color: #0900FE; } /* ... باقي الكود ... */ </style> <script> const generateBtn = document.getElementById("generate-btn"); const outputContainer = document.getElementById("output-container"); const outputText = document.getElementById("output-text"); const copyBtn = document.getElementById("copy-btn"); generateBtn.addEventListener("click", () => { const websiteUrl = document.getElementById("website-url").value; const platform = document.getElementById("platform-select").value; let robotsTxtContent = ""; if (platform === "blogger") { robotsTxtContent = `User-agent: * Disallow: /search Disallow: /p/ Disallow: /?m=1 Sitemap: ${websiteUrl}/atom.xml?redirect=false&start-index=1&max-results=500`; } else if (platform === "wordpress") { robotsTxtContent = `User-agent: * Disallow: /wp-admin/ Disallow: /wp-includes/ Sitemap: ${websiteUrl}/sitemap.xml`; } outputText.innerText = robotsTxtContent; outputContainer.style.display = "block"; copyBtn.style.display = "block"; const textLength = robotsTxtContent.length; let i = 0; const typeEffectInterval = setInterval(() => { outputText.innerText = robotsTxtContent.slice(0, i); i++; if (i > textLength) { clearInterval(typeEffectInterval); } }, 50); }); copyBtn.addEventListener("click", () => { const copyText = document.createElement("textarea"); copyText.value = outputText.innerText; document.body.appendChild(copyText); copyText.select(); document.execCommand("copy"); document.body.removeChild(copyText); alert("Copied to clipboard!"); }); </script>
من خلال إنشاء ملف Robots.txt مثالي، يمكنك:
باستخدام أداة مولد ملف Robots.txt، يمكنك إنشاء ملف مخصص بناءً على احتياجات موقعك:
لتوليد ملف Robots.txt مخصص وتحسين ظهور موقعك في نتائج محركات البحث، يمكنك اتباع هذه الخطوات البسيطة:
User-agent: *
للسماح لجميع محركات البحث بالوصول أو استخدام Disallow
لمنع فهرسة صفحات معينة./robots.txt
).هكذا و من خلال تحسين إعدادات ملف Robots.txt، يمكنك ضمان أن محركات البحث تفهرس الصفحات التي تهمك فقط، مما يساعد على تحسين ترتيب موقعك في نتائج البحث.
إليك بعض الفوائد الرئيسية لاستخدام هذه الأداة:
بعد إنشاء الملف باستخدام الأداة، يمكنك رفعه إلى المجلد الجذري لموقعك (عادةً يكون على المسار /robots.txt
). و بهذه الطريقة الرائعة ، ستتعامل جميع محركات البحث مع تعليماتك بالشكل الصحيح.
تم النشر بواسطة Gpldroid Seotools Apps